The market is dominated by foreign suppliers, as imports account for 63.6% of total market size in 2023. B2B drives market demand, with B2B spending representing 65.7% of total demand in 2023. South Korea has the fifth largest market size for aircraft and spacecraft regionally, with demand reaching USD10.1 billion in 2023. Korea Aerospace Industries Ltd is the largest company in South Korea, generating 35.6% of the industry’s total production value in 2023. The industry is fragmented, with the top five companies generating 45.9% of total production value in 2023. The total number of companies increases in 2023, to 396 units. The costs of the industry increase by 2.9% in 2023, largely driven by rising B2B costs. The industry’s profitability decreases and stands at 5.4% of production value in 2023, the 19th highest regionally. The industry’s exports share decreases in 2023 to 42.2% of total production output. With production value of USD6.1 billion, South Korea accounts for 5.5% of the Asia Pacific total in 2023.
